Electric cars in the UK run on DC electricity (although this is supplied in AC and converted to DC), with their batteries typically operating at voltages ranging from around 400 to 800 volts, depending on the make and model of the car. The high voltage is necessary to provide the power needed. Voltage, often denoted by the letter “V”, is a measure of the electric potential difference between two points in an electric circuit. How many volts does an electric car battery use?
The typical voltage range for electric car batteries is 400-800 volts, which translates to 100-200 kilowatt-hours of energy. Higher voltage batteries can provide a longer driving range and quicker acceleration. However, it is essential to note that higher voltage batteries come at a higher cost.
Why do electric car batteries have a higher voltage?
The higher the voltage, the more energy the battery can supply to power the vehicle, allowing it to travel further on a single charge. Electric car manufacturers have been working to increase the voltage of their batteries in order to improve vehicle range and performance.
What is battery voltage?
In simple terms, battery voltage refers to the amount of electric potential a battery can deliver at its terminals. The voltage of electric car batteries is a crucial component in determining the range of an electric vehicle, and has a direct effect on its overall performance.
